Output 63d7971f434582b9b18c8434e1982aa093a4f33a66c1307766e82f21640556d7:0

value
317806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d6d9e301731c500d49444638032200e8b9cadfe OP_EQUAL
address
3Qo2CTqd8SxGhz8vPa7W5P5WHb7LaYAat8
transaction
63d7971f434582b9b18c8434e1982aa093a4f33a66c1307766e82f21640556d7
spent
true